Why is the light flashing on my Craftsman garage door opener?

Your garage door relies on the use of sensors to ensure that the garage will reverse the closing of the door when it detects motion beneath the garage door. If the sensors are not properly connected, the garage door light will blink continuously and the door will refuse to close.

What does 5 blinks mean on Craftsman garage door opener?

5 Flashes. This means the opener is not detecting any RPM's (rotations-per-minute) during the first second of operation. This typically means there is a mechanical stoppage: If the opener is operating normally.

Is there a reset button on a garage door opener?

Generally, newer garage openers have a button that will reset the system. If you own an older model, the garage opener uses a dual in-line package (DIP) to operate the system. The systems that use a DIP rely on radio frequencies and switches, while newer garage door openers use wireless signals.

Why is my garage door not closing and light flashing?

When you see your garage door opener lights flashing and the garage door will not close, it could be the safety reversing sensors or the LOCK button. If there is a safety reversing sensor issue, the main light(s) flash 10 times. Start with aligning the safety sensors.

What does 4 blinks mean on Craftsman garage door opener?

Four flashes typically indicate sensor eyes that are misaligned. If the sensor eyes are misaligned, it means the electronic beam is broken. This keeps the garage door from closing completely, and it will stop, reverse, and re-open.

What does two blinks indicate on a garage sensor problem?

Two flashes indicate that your sensor wire is either shorted or the black and white wires could be reversed. In both cases, your safety eyes will not glow steadily. You should inspect the wiring for any staples or incorrect wiring.

Why is my garage door opener clicking and flashing?

If your garage door opener is clicking, it is probably also flashing a light on and off. If this is the case, you have likely locked your opener by mistake. A lot of homeowners will accidentally put their opener into lock mode by sliding a switch or holding a lock button too long on the wall control station.

What does flashing red light mean on garage door sensor?

Green lights mean the sensors are working, while red lights indicate the sensors are not aligned. If you see red lights, try inspecting the bracket or tightening a screw on the blinking sensor. You'll know you fixed the sensor if the light stops blinking and your garage door closes properly again.

How do you reset a Craftsman garage door after a power outage?

How to Reconnect Your Garage Door Opener After a Power Outage

  1. First you must disconnect the garage door opener from the door itself.
  2. Pull the emergency disconnect cord hanging from the opener. ...
  3. Manually close the door all the way. ...
  4. After the power has been restored, press the button you typically use to close the door.

Does unplugging your garage door opener reset it?

The first thing you will likely need to do in order to reset your garage door is to unplug it or shut off the breaker that it is connected to. This will shut off power to the door entirely. From there, you should wait at least ten seconds before turning the power to the door itself back on.

How do I know if my garage door sensor is bad?

The green lights on your garage door sensors typically let you know that everything is working as it should. If the green light is flashing or is not illuminated, there's a problem with your sensor. You can test your garage door sensors by placing a cardboard box that's over 6 inches tall in the way of the sensors.

Where are DIP switches on Craftsman garage door opener?

DIP stands for Dual Inline Package which is found in older models of Craftsman garage door openers. They are usually located inside the remote control, near the batteries. It is encased in a slide cover. When you open the cover, you will see at least eight rows of tiny switches.
